Как импортировать NLTK в Python 3.7 на Mac? - PullRequest
0 голосов
/ 30 марта 2019

Я пытался импортировать набор естественных языков (NLTK) в соответствии с кодом, указанным в https://www.nltk.org/install.html.

Этот код работает в окне терминала на моем компьютере Mac (10.14), но отказываетсяимпортировать NLTK в интерпретатор, поставляемый с Python (IDLE).

Я уже пытался изменить каталог, импортировав модуль os.(Изменил каталог на библиотеку Python по умолчанию в macOS).Это, в свою очередь, приводит к ошибкам самих скриптов NLTK.

Это код, который я запустил

>>> import os

>>> os.getcwd()

>>> os.chdir('/Library/Python/2.7/site-packages')

>>> import nltk

Я ожидал, что nltk успешно импортируется после смены каталога.

Тем не менее, он показывает ошибки в самих сценариях NLTK (я полагаю), а именно:

"Traceback (последний вызов был последним):

Файл "", строка 1, в импорте nltk

Файл "/Library/Python/2.7/site-packages/nltk/init.py", строка 99, в

from nltk.internals import config_java

Файл "/Library/Python/2.7/site-packages/nltk/internals.py", строка 28, в

from six import string_types

ModuleNotFoundError: Нет модуля с именем 'six' '

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...